A venturi meter is a device for measuring the speed of a fluidwithin a pipe. The drawing shows a gas flowing at a speed v2through a horizontal section of pipe whose cross-sectional area A2= 0.0800 m2. The gas has a density of ? = 1.40 kg/m3. The Venturimeter has a cross-sectional area of A1 = 0.0300 m2 and has beensubstituted for a section of the larger pipe. The pressuredifference between the two sections is P2 - P1 = 170 Pa.
(a) Find the speed v2 of the gas in the larger original pipe.

(b) Find the volume flow rate Q of the gas.
